Meaning
Definitions
adjective
involving or characterized by harmony
adjective
relating to vibrations that occur as a result of vibrations in a nearby body
“sympathetic vibration”
adjective
of or relating to harmony as distinct from melody and rhythm
“{'source': 'Ralph Hill', 'text': 'subtleties of harmonic change and tonality'}”
adjective
of or relating to the branch of acoustics that studies the composition of musical sounds
“the sound of the resonating cavity cannot be the only determinant of the harmonic response”
adjective
of or relating to harmonics
noun
any of a series of musical tones whose frequencies are integral multiples of the frequency of a fundamental
noun
a tone that is a component of a complex sound
